【问题标题】:SharePoint Workflow Only Works For Me?SharePoint 工作流仅适用于我?
【发布时间】:2017-09-25 22:42:58
【问题描述】:

好的,我有一个内置于 SharePoint 2010 中的工作流,内置于 SharePoint Designer 中。它设置为在创建新项目时开始。该库还设置为基于电子邮件附件创建新项目。因此,目标是让用户通过电子邮件将附件发送到库,然后工作流程接管。

工作流程只对我有用。尝试使用它的其他人在权限中列为完全控制。他们使用了正确的电子邮件地址,图书馆正在根据附件创建新项目。问题是工作流一直说发生了错误。

该错误表明某些列需要不同类型的数据,但是当我通过电子邮件发送到库时,它会顺利运行。

我完全不知道他们发送电子邮件而不是我发送电子邮件有什么不同。

对不起,我有点啰嗦,提前感谢您的帮助。

【问题讨论】:

    标签: sharepoint-2010 workflow sharepoint-workflow


    【解决方案1】:

    不允许系统帐户自行启动工作流。您需要运行一个 powershell 以启用系统帐户来运行工作流。还可以在工作流程中尝试模拟。

    在这里找到了。 stsadm.exe –o setproperty –propertyname declarativeworkflowautostartonemailenabled –propertyvalue 是

    【讨论】:

    • 但系统帐户在不同的库中运行相同的工作流程,并在我通过电子邮件发送文档时运行工作流程。在这两种情况下,它都完全按照设计工作,无需任何类型的手动启动/批准。
    • 它适合你,因为你是工作流作者。将该工作流程置于模拟之下。那么它应该可以工作了。
    • 重做了它,它工作了,然后又坏了,然后看到了这个关于模仿的评论。这似乎是解决办法,你是我的英雄。
    【解决方案2】:

    不确定它出了什么问题,但我只是删除了它然后重建它,现在它可以工作了。不要认为我做了什么不同的事情,所以我不确定。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2010-10-08
      • 1970-01-01
      • 2015-10-09
      • 2010-10-25
      • 1970-01-01
      相关资源
      最近更新 更多